
Ted Macaluso writes tales of adventure, romance, and science fiction. With lots of art. His first book, Vincent, Theo and the Fox, is an adventure story about Vincent van Gogh and growing up (picture book/early reader for ages 4-10). Kirkus Reviews called it “…a charming, unique way to introduce youngsters to great art while providing an important message.” The Washington Post wrote “…the colorful paintings jump off the pages and will give you a lot to think about….it’s cool. Very cool.” Ted’s short story, The Recall, was a winner in The Washington City Paper’s 2018 Fiction Contest.
